چکیده :
Vibration in high-voltage circuit breakers is a critical parameter, as significant forces and speeds are required to disconnect the contacts, which aids in arc quenching. Any alterations in the disconnecting chamber or breaker mechanism lead to changes in the vibration patterns, making it a valuable indicator for detecting potential issues. By monitoring this vibration, key data can be collected to identify faulty contacts, switches, or to predict potential performance failures in the circuit breaker. This paper presents the use of an accelerometer sensor to measure the vibration of a medium-voltage circuit breaker. A microcontroller is employed to store the sensor’s output for future analysis, and electric circuits are implemented to convert the sensor signal into a suitable voltage for the analog-to-digital converter (ADC). The collected vibration data is then processed using Fourier transform techniques. Comparative analysis of the vibration data from two medium-voltage circuit breakers—one in optimal condition and the other with a minor defect—demonstrates how the technique can effectively detect faults in the circuit breaker by analyzing distinct differences in their vibration profiles.
